Code P145A Lincoln Description

The P145A diagnostic trouble code (DTC) in a Lincoln vehicle indicates that the A/C pressure is insufficient, leading to the disabling of the A/C clutch. This issue can have a significant impact on the vehicle's overall performance and comfort, especially during hot weather or in regions where air conditioning is essential. Common Causes of P145A Lincoln

  1. Low refrigerant levels in the A/C system.
  2. Malfunctioning A/C pressure sensor.
  3. Faulty A/C compressor clutch.
  4. A/C system leaks.
  5. Electrical issues with the A/C system components.

Symptoms of P145A Lincoln

  1. Insufficient cooling or lack of cold air from the A/C system.
  2. A noticeable decrease in A/C performance.
  3. A/C compressor not engaging or disengaging properly.
  4. Strange noises coming from the A/C system.
  5. A/C system cycling on and off frequently.

How to Fix P145A Lincoln

  1. Perform a thorough inspection of the A/C system to identify any leaks or damage.
  2. Check and replenish refrigerant levels in the A/C system as needed.
  3. Test the A/C pressure sensor and replace if faulty.
  4. Inspect the A/C compressor clutch for proper function and replace if necessary.
  5. Clear the DTC and reset the A/C system to ensure proper operation.

Cost to Fix P145A Lincoln

The cost of repairing a P145A diagnostic trouble code in a Lincoln vehicle can vary depending on the specific issue causing the code and the labor rates at the repair shop. On average, the repair costs for this issue can range from $200 to $500, including parts and labor. It's important to note that the exact diagnosis time and labor rates at auto repair shops can vary based on factors such as location, vehicle make and model, and engine type. Therefore, it is recommended to obtain quotes from local repair shops for a more accurate estimate.
